How Full Service Brokerage Firms Actually Work
A full service brokerage firm handles all critical parts of a real estate transaction under one roof. This includes property matching based on detailed client profiles, negotiation support, contract preparation, financing coordination, and finalizing closing documents. Brokers act as intermediaries between clients, lenders, inspectors, and inspectors while ensuring compliance with local regulations. Importantly, they serve as fiduciaries—legally bound to act in the client’s best interest—offering guidance without hidden agendas. This integrated model reduces fragmentation, lowering the risk of missed steps and miscommunication.
